  • Abstract
    Vertical void fraction distributions in cold gassed, hot sparged and boiling systems using different agitators with multiple modern hollow blade and up-pumping wide-blade hydrofoil impellers are reported. The void fraction in boiling systems is dramatically different from that in cold gassed or hot sparged systems whether in terms of value or distribution. Under the same gas phase output conditions, the void fraction is much smaller in boiling systems than in cold gassed or hot sparging systems. Hot sparged systems have similar vertical void fraction distributions, with maxima in similar locations but with smaller void fractions overall, like those of cold gassed systems. The results are of particular relevance to the design and operation of reactors with hot sparging or boiling liquids.
